RACHIALLE FRANKLIN, Defendant. / ORDER DENYING APPLICATION TO PROCEED IN FORMA PAUPERIS AND DISMISSING CASE 14 15 The Court has received Plaintiff’s complaint and application to proceed in forma 16 pauperis, both filed in this Court on December 5, 2011. The Court may authorize a plaintiff to 17 file an action in federal court without prepayment of fees or security if the plaintiff submits an 18 affidavit showing that he or she is unable to pay such fees or give security therefor. 28 U.S.C. § 19 1915(a). The in forma pauperis statute also provides that the Court shall dismiss the case if at 20 any time the Court determines that the allegation of poverty is untrue, or that the action (1) is 21 frivolous or malicious; (2) fails to state a claim on which relief may be granted; or (3) seeks 22 monetary relief against a defendant who is immune from such relief. 28 U.S.C. § 1915(e)(2). 23 Plaintiff has failed to set forth “a short and plain statement of the claim showing that the 24 pleader is entitled to relief” as required by Rule 8 of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ure. 25 Plaintiff’s complaint fails to state a claim upon which relief can be granted because he fails to 26 allege that Defendant was acting on behalf of the federal or state government. See Public 27 Utilities Comm’n of Dist. of Columbia v. Pollak, 343 U.S. 451, 461 (1952) (holding that the 28 First and Fifth Amendments “apply to and restrict only the Federal Government and not private 1 persons.”); see also West v. Adkins, 487 U.S. 42, 48-49 (1988) (holding that a claim for relief 2 under 42 U.S.C. § 1983 requires a showing of constitutional violations committed by persons 3 acting under color of state law). 4 Accordingly, the Court HEREBY DISMISSES the complaint with leave to amend and 5 DENIES the application to proceed in forma pauperis. If Plaintiff wishes to pursue this action, 6 he must file an amended complaint and a renewed application to proceed in forma pauperis by 7 January 3, 2012. Failure to file a cognizable legal claim by this date shall result in dismissal of 8 this action with prejudice.
